2026年虚拟币钱包开发全攻略:从构想到上线的完

                                ## 内容主体大纲 1. 引言 - 介绍虚拟币钱包的背景与发展趋势 - 阐述为什么开发虚拟币钱包是一个有前景的行业 2. 虚拟币钱包的类型 - 热钱包与冷钱包的区别 - 硬件钱包和软件钱包的比较 - 多签名钱包的优势和用途 3. 开发虚拟币钱包的技术基础 - 区块链技术概述 - 加密算法的重要性 - 网络通信协议的选择 4. 开发流程详解 - 需求分析与市场调研 - 技术选型与架构设计 - 界面设计与用户体验 - 后端开发与区块链交互 - 安全措施与加密存储 - 测试与部署 5. 钱包的安全性考量 - 常见安全威胁与应对策略 - 冷存储与多签名机制的运用 - 数据保护与隐私保护 6. 上线后维持与迭代 - 用户反馈的收集与分析 - 更新与维护的最佳实践 - 持续技术支持和客户服务 7. 未来趋势与展望 - 增长潜力与市场动态 - 新技术对虚拟币钱包的影响 - 法规与合规性对市场的影响 ## 内容主体 ### 引言

                                随着区块链技术的迅速发展,虚拟货币的普及度日益增加。越来越多的人开始关注虚拟币的钱包开发,尤其是面对越来越复杂的数字货币生态,这一领域的发展前景广阔。开发一个功能齐全且安全的虚拟币钱包,不仅能帮助用户安全地管理数字资产,还能为开发者带来可观的经济利益,因此,了解虚拟币钱包的开发流程变得尤为重要。

                                ### 虚拟币钱包的类型

                                在开始开发之前,首先需要了解虚拟币钱包的不同类型。主要有热钱包和冷钱包两种:

                                -

                                热钱包

                                热钱包是指那些常在线、连接到互联网的钱包,方便用户随时进行交易,但相对来说安全性较差。常见的如应用程序钱包、在线钱包等。

                                -

                                冷钱包

                                冷钱包则是在没有连接到互联网的状态下存储虚拟币,安全性更高,适合长期存储。最常见的冷钱包包括硬件钱包和纸钱包。

                                此外,多签名钱包在安全性上也具有独特优势。支持多个密钥签署交易,从而在决策和资金管理上提供更高的安全保障。

                                ### 开发虚拟币钱包的技术基础

                                虚拟币钱包的开发离不开区块链技术及其相关的加密算法。在进行开发之前,团队需要对这些技术有一个全面的了解。

                                -

                                区块链技术概述

                                区块链是一种去中心化的分布式账本技术,每一个交易都通过网络节点进行验证。了解区块链的基本原理是开发虚拟币钱包的基础。

                                -

                                加密算法的重要性

                                虚拟币的安全性依赖于加密算法。对比各种加密算法如SHA-256、RIPEMD-160等,选择那些适合付款及存储余额的算法。

                                -

                                网络通信协议的选择

                                为了保证钱包与区块链网络之间的高效交互,开发者需选择合适的网络协议,如HTTP、WebSocket等。

                                ### 开发流程详解

                                接下来,我们来看看虚拟币钱包的开发流程。

                                -

                                需求分析与市场调研

                                在开发之前,必须对市场需求进行仔细分析,了解目标用户的需求和痛点。此外,对现有市场上已有钱包的功能进行评估和比对也至关重要。

                                -

                                技术选型与架构设计

                                根据需求进行技术的选型,选择合适的编程语言(如JavaScript、Python等)、数据库及框架。在架构设计上,确保系统的可扩展性与灵活性。

                                -

                                界面设计与用户体验

                                开发一个用户友好的界面是钱包成功的关键。需要关注用户的操作流程,确保新用户能够快速上手。

                                -

                                后端开发与区块链交互

                                后端的开发包括用户账户管理、钱包地址生成及交易处理。这一部分需要与区块链网络进行良好的交互,以确保交易的顺利进行。

                                -

                                安全措施与加密存储

                                安全是钱包开发中的重中之重。需要实现数据的加密存储、多因素认证等措施,以保证用户资产的安全。

                                -

                                测试与部署

                                在完成开发后,进行全面的测试,包括功能测试、安全测试和性能测试等,确保钱包的稳定与安全。最后,将钱包部署到服务器并进行上线。

                                ### 钱包的安全性考量

                                在开发过程中,安全性问题始终是最高优先级。

                                -

                                常见安全威胁与应对策略

                                如黑客攻击、钓鱼行为等,了解这些威胁可以有效设计出应对措施。例如,使用防火墙、入侵检测系统等保护用户资产。

                                -

                                冷存储与多签名机制的运用

                                冷存储可以有效防止黑客入侵,结合多签名机制,可以进一步提升资产的安全性,这些策略是保障用户资金的有效方法。

                                -

                                数据保护与隐私保护

                                使用加密技术保护用户的敏感信息,确保用户的隐私不会在交易中泄露,同时符合各地隐私法规。

                                ### 上线后维持与迭代

                                钱包上线后,维持与迭代同样重要。

                                -

                                用户反馈的收集与分析

                                通过用户反馈,了解他们的需求和改进意见,以此为基础,持续钱包的功能和用户体验。

                                -

                                更新与维护的最佳实践

                                定期更新系统,提高安全性和性能。同时,保持沟通与用户,并及时响应他们的问题。

                                -

                                持续技术支持和客户服务

                                技术支持确保用户在使用过程中拥有良好的体验,提供7/24小时的客服服务,可以建立良好的用户关系,提高客户粘性。

                                ### 未来趋势与展望

                                最后,我们探讨虚拟币钱包未来的发展趋势。

                                -

                                增长潜力与市场动态

                                随着区块链技术的成熟和政策的逐步规范,虚拟币钱包市场有着巨大的增长潜力。预计未来将会有更多用户参与进来,并且钱包的功能会不断扩展。

                                -

                                新技术对虚拟币钱包的影响

                                例如人工智能与大数据的结合,将推动钱包的智能化,提供更为个性化的服务。

                                -

                                法规与合规性对市场的影响

                                合规性将成为影响钱包开发的重要因素,始终关注法律法规,可以帮助开发者更好地规划钱包的功能与市场策略。

                                ## 相关问题 ### 虚拟币钱包的市场前景如何?

                                虚拟币钱包的市场前景如何?

                                随着数字货币的快速普及,虚拟币钱包的市场需求持续增长。越来越多的人和企业开始认识到虚拟资产的重要性,推动了各类钱包的开发。

                                ### 开发虚拟币钱包需要考虑哪些法律法规?

                                开发虚拟币钱包需要考虑哪些法律法规?

                                各种国家和地区对虚拟货币和钱包的监管法规各不相同,开发者需关注法律动态,确保合规性。

                                ### 虚拟币钱包的安全策略有哪些?

                                虚拟币钱包的安全策略有哪些?

                                确保用户资产安全是钱包开发的首要任务,采取多种安全策略,如加密存储、两步验证等。

                                ### 开发虚拟币钱包时需要哪些团队角色?

                                开发虚拟币钱包时需要哪些团队角色?

                                开发团队通常包括前端开发、后端开发、UI/UX设计师、安全专家等角色,各司其职。

                                ### 用户体验在虚拟币钱包开发中的重要性?

                                用户体验在虚拟币钱包开发中的重要性?

                                优质的用户体验能够吸引用户使用钱包并提高用户留存率,影响钱包的竞争力。

                                ### 如何应对虚拟币钱包开发中的技术挑战?

                                如何应对虚拟币钱包开发中的技术挑战?

                                通过持续学习和借助先进的技术框架,开发团队可以有效应对技术挑战,确保钱包的稳定和安全。

                                                              author

                                                              Appnox App

                                                              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                                        related post

                                                                                    leave a reply